What's The Story

Bus #2969 (1948), one of the first 40-ft transit buses, was designed specifically for New York City. It features a double-width front door to expedite passenger loading and unloading. Known as the “Jackie Gleason Bus,” it was originally bus #4789, but was renumbered to match the bus that the comedian was photographed in as Ralph Kramden in the classic television series “The Honeymooners.”
